About The Role
We are looking for an experienced Fleet Manager to oversee and manage the company’s vehicles and grey fleet, ensuring they are safe, efficient, and compliant with current regulations.
Key Responsibilities:
* Oversee fleet operations, ensuring vehicles meet safety, efficiency, and regulatory standards.
* Optimise fleet performance at the optimal cost.
* Own and manage fleet policies.
* Provide leadership, support, and expertise to senior management across transport, warehousing, nursing, and centralised functions (H&S, HR, Finance, Quality Assurance).
* Ensure compliance with vehicle safety regulations, emissions standards, taxation requirements, permits, and driver certifications.
* Manage day-to-day fleet operations to ensure efficiency.
* Control and manage fleet costs, including fuel, repairs, insurance, and leasing.
* Analyse fleet data and provide insights using telematics, spend data, and market intelligence.
* Manage supply chain and vehicle life cycles.
About You
We are seeking a candidate with an IMI qualification or extensive industry experience, strong knowledge of vehicle mechanics, fleet management software, and maintenance procedures. Familiarity with fleet regulations (health and safety, emissions, taxation, and driver licensing) is essential, as well as experience in accident and insurance management.
You should be proficient in budgeting, cost analysis, and managing fuel, insurance, maintenance, and depreciation. Strong skills in data analysis, communication, and problem-solving are required, alongside leadership experience managing a remote team.
A commitment to excellent customer service, knowledge of eco-driving and alternative fuels, and the ability to adopt new technologies are essential.

About Us
At Lloyds Clinical, with over four decades of experience supporting patients since 1975, we are dedicated to delivering exceptional clinical homecare services to more than 100,000 patients in their own homes, workplaces, or communities across the UK. Our comprehensive range of treatments spans from medication delivery to specialised nursing for complex conditions such as home parenteral nutrition, chemotherapy, IV antibiotics, enzyme replacement therapy, rheumatoid arthritis, multiple sclerosis, and beyond. Working in collaboration with the NHS, pharmaceutical companies, and private medical insurers, we prioritise patient care and are guided by our values of Delivering together, Being Accountable, Giving it our all and Continually Improving to provide the highest standards of service delivery and patient outcomes.
